the skeletal and muscular systems:

The adult skeletal system is a framework of 206 bone

  • Hold the body together
  • Give it shape
  • Protect organs and tissues
The skeleton also provides anchore points for the muscular system, wich includes three types of muscles found throughout the body and facilitate movement :

cardiovascular system:

Pipeline that includes the Heart, blood vessels and blood itself.It delivers oxygene, white blood cells, hormones and nutriants throughout the body .

nervous system:

The NS is a communication network of nerve cells that the body uses to transmit information and coordinates body functions.It is comprised of :

  • the Brain the hub of sensory and intellectual activities
  • the Spinal Cord
  • Cranial nerves
  • Spinal nerves

Endocrine system :

Makes hormones that control your moods, growth and development, metabolism, organs, and reproduction. Controls how your hormones are released using informations carried by the nervous system . Sends those hormones into your bloodstream so they can travel to other body parts.

lymphatic system:

The lymphatic system also walled the immune system helps regulate the body's deffense . It also maintains fluid levels in our body tissues by removing all fluids that leak out of our blood vessels. Besides lymph vessels the LS contains :

Spleen and Thymus

Lymphatic organs that monitor the blood and detect and respond to pathogens and malignant cells.

Lymph nodes

Produce cells and antibodies which protect our body from infection and disease.

The system contains two kidneys, which control the electrolyte composition of the blood and eliminate dissolved waste products and excess amounts of other substances from the blood; the latter substances are excreted in the urine, which passes from the kidneys to the bladder by way of two thin muscular tubes called the ureters then it is eliminated through the urethra.

respiratory system :

This system is a group of passageways and organs that extracts life-giving oxygen from the air we breath. The lungs extract oxygen for the body to use then expel a carbon dioxide by product when we exhale.

Digestive System:

It is an approximatly 9 meters series of organs that covnert food into fuel .food enters the system through the mouth and then moves into the esophages ,the stomach and the intestins.Nutriments are absorbed into the body while the solide waste expelled through the anal canal the end of the digestive tract .
